Ginneries get phutti of 14.78m bales: Textiles buy 13.57m, exporters 473,337, TCP 94,900 bales

MULTAN: Till March 15, 2015, seed cotton (Phutti) of 14.78 million bales has reached ginneries across the country registering a percentage increase in arrivals by 10.59 per cent versus corresponding period of 2014, as per a fortnightly report of Pakistan Cotton Ginners Association (PCGA)

The report added phutti equivalent to 14,785,795 bales had reached ginning factories and 14.75m of them have undergone the ginning process. The arrival at Punjab ginneries was recorded at 10.81 million bales recording a percentage increase of 12.49 per cent compared to corresponding period of last year.

Showing a percentage increase of 5.74 per cent, arrivals at ginneries in Sindh was recorded at 3.97 million bales. Textile Mills have purchased 13.57 million bales, exporters bought 473,337 bales while Trading Corporation of Pakistan (TCP) procured 94,900 bales.

It said total sold out bales were calculated at 14.14 million bales. Exactly 644,986 bales were still lying with the ginneries as the unsold stock.
